What Are CS: GO Skins?
CS: GO skins are cosmetic modifications used to in-game weapons, knives, and gloves. They do not modify gameplay, provide no competitive advantages, and do not make a weapon shoot faster or more accurately. Their value is completely originated from visual appeal, rarity, historic significance, and community demand.

Rarity Tiers and Drop Mechanics
Valve organizes weapon finishes into unique rarity tiers, generally communicated through color-coding. The drop rate reduces substantially as the tier increases, directly affecting market price.
Rarity TierColor CodeDescriptionApproximate Drop/Unbox ProbabilityConsumer GradeWhiteCommon, basic weapon surfaces.Found by means of weekly drops/ default.Industrial GradeLight BlueSlightly better than customer grade.Common weekly drops.Mil-SpecBlueBasic weapon skin tier.~ 79.92% (from cases)RestrictedPurpleAbove average quality.~ 15.98% (from cases)ClassifiedPinkHigh-tier skins, highly looked for after.~ 3.20% (from cases)CovertRedThe highest basic tier for weapons.~ 0.64% (from cases)Exceedingly RareGoldKnives and Special Wearable Gloves.~ 0.26% (from cases)
Beyond standard wear rankings, some skins feature a StatTrak ™ technology module, which physically engraves kill counts onto the side of the weapon. StatTrak variants generally command a greater cost than their non-StatTrak equivalents. Moreover, certain patterns (like the famous "Case Hardened" blue gems) count on a pattern index that can make a particular skin entirely distinct and worth tens of thousands of dollars.
The Economics of Counter-Strike
What makes the CS: GO/CS2 skin community remarkable is its decentralized, player-driven economy. Unlike games where microtransactions are locked to an account, Valve produced a system where virtual items possess real-world liquidity.
Skins can be traded peer-to-peer, purchased and sold on the Steam Community Market, or exchanged through third-party markets using genuine currency (cryptocurrency, bank transfers, or PayPal).
